Understanding Legal Aid

Legal help in Haralson County GA refers to services offered to support individuals in working through the legal system, including legal defense, advice, and insight. These services are typically made available to people with low incomes who cannot afford private attorneys.

Varieties of Legal Aid

Legal aid can take multiple forms, depending on the specific legal matter and the resources available. Some of the typical forms include:

Court Representation:

This entails assigning a lawyer to advocate for someone in court. This is especially important in criminal matters, where the outcome can have a major effect on someone’s life and freedom.

Advice and Counseling Services:

Many legal aid organizations provide advice and counseling to assist people in comprehending their legal rights and choices. This can include assistance with drafting legal documents or giving advice on how to move forward with a legal issue.

Volunteer Legal Services:

Pro bono assistance are offered by private attorneys who donate their time to give free legal help to people who need it. Numerous law firms and individual attorneys accept pro bono cases as part of their professional commitment to public service.

Community Legal Clinics:

Legal clinics are often run by law schools or charitable organizations and offer free or affordable legal services to the community. These clinics may focus on specific areas of law, such as family law or immigration.

Web-Based Resources:

With the advent of technology, many legal support groups now offer online resources, including legal information, self-help guides, and virtual consultations. These resources can be particularly useful for individuals who might not have easy access to brick-and-mortar legal aid offices.

Challenges Facing Legal Aid

Even though it is vital, legal assistance services deal with multiple issues:

Demand Exceeding Supply:

The demand for legal aid services frequently exceeds the supply. This means that numerous people who seek legal support may not be able to get it promptly, or at all. This imbalance can lead to overburdened legal aid attorneys and clients experiencing longer waits.

Understanding:

There is frequently a lack of knowledge about the existence of legal aid services. Many individuals who might gain from legal aid may not be aware that these services are available or how to access them. Increasing public awareness is key to making sure more individuals use these resources.

Geographic Disparities:

Legal aid access can vary significantly depending on geographic location. Rural regions, specifically, may have less legal aid availability compared to urban areas, creating disparities in access to justice.
